In a move that highlights the Kingdom of Cambodia's commitment to regional cooperation,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ation SOK Chenda Sophea will participate in the upcoming ASEAN Foreign Ministers' Retreat in Luang Prabang, Laos. The announcement made on 25 Jan 2024, has shed light on the significance of this gathering.
Under the theme "ASEAN: Enhancing Connectivity and Resilience", the retreat aims to discuss priorities and key deliverables under the Lao chairmanship of ASEAN this year. Ministers will also focus on follow-ups to the 43rd ASEAN Summit in Jakarta last year and ways forward for ASEAN Community building, including progress in developing the ASEAN Community Vision 2045.
During the retreat, Deputy Prime Minister Sophea will engage in bilateral talks with several counterparts to expand mutually beneficial cooperation under bilateral and multilateral frameworks. These discussions are expected to foster stronger ties between Cambodia and its neighboring countries within the Association of Southeast Asian Nations (ASEAN).
